Output fc01dab69587c354fcb2db0d7bb11967e9700267e67fa5f535c740d3406b18c6:3

value
26555981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62f4ea0ae31d4ae1a6f9a0832727eafeb27ea223 OP_EQUAL
address
MGvPrAj6DkPYo6oHDU2VJ7qg5SLRYUcGYy
transaction
fc01dab69587c354fcb2db0d7bb11967e9700267e67fa5f535c740d3406b18c6
spent
true